The CCNP Security (300-730 SVPN) certification from Cisco is for professionals engaged in securing VPN solutions and remote access in network environments. This certification validates a candidate's skills to design, implement, and troubleshoot secure access solutions, including site-to-site and remote access VPNs using Cisco technologies. With the increasing importance on secure connectivity in ever connected world, the CCNP Security (300-730 SVPN) certification assess network security professionals for the skills needed to protect data and manage remote access securely. CCNP Security (300-730 SVPN) Certification Course Outline
The CCNP Security (300-730 SVPN) Certification covers the following topics -
Module 1. Site-to-site Virtual Private Networks on Routers and Firewalls
Explain GETVPN
DMVPN implementation
FlexVPN using local AAA implementation
Module 2. Remote access VPNs
AnyConnect IKEv2 VPNs on ASA and routers implementation
AnyConnect SSL VPN on ASA implementation
Clientless SSL VPN on ASA implementation
Flex VPN on routers implementation
Module 3. Troubleshooting using ASDM and CLI
IPsec troubleshooting
DMVPN troubleshooting
FlexVPN troubleshooting
AnyConnect IKEv2 and SSL VPNs on ASA and routers troubleshooting
and Clientless SSL VPN on ASA troubleshooting
Module 4. Secure Communications Architectures
The various functional components of GETVPN, FlexVPN, DMVPN, and IPsec for site-to-site VPN solutions
The various functional components of FlexVPN, IPsec, and Clientless SSL for remote access VPN solutions
VPN technology as per the configuration output for site-to-site VPN solutions
VPN technology as per the configuration output for remote access VPN solutions
The split tunneling requirements for the remote access VPN solutions
